Posted by cosmological
As most of you know, I'm designing this level. Let me give you a brief overview of what i'm planning on doing.

So star 1 is going to go on the 9 holes idea. I'll be mixing in concepts from both miniature gold as well as regular golf (of course with changes to make them more galaxy like). Some plans I have are windmills, holes based off of wii sports and wii sports resort courses. I've already designed 3 of the holes on paper (but a freak thunderstorm destroyed it because it was on my windowsill). I will also be modeling the design that I make..



For the windmill part, I think you should make it an asteroid belt-like windfarm. That would be an interseting approach and keep it different from Bianco Hills.
